class Lockout: | ||
"""Lock out an async resource for an amount of time | ||
Resources may be locked out multiple times. | ||
Only prevents new acquires and does not cancel ongoing scopes that | ||
have already acquired access. | ||
Does not guarantee FIFO acquisition. | ||
When paired with locks, semaphores, or ratelimiters, this should | ||
be the last synchonization acquired and should be acquired immediately. | ||
Example use could look similar to: | ||
>>> ratelimiter = Ratelimiter(5, 1, 1) | ||
>>> lockout = Lockout() | ||
>>> async def request_handler(route, parameters): | ||
async with ratelimiter, lockout: | ||
response = await some_request(route, **parameters) | ||
if response.code == 429: | ||
if reset_after := headers.get('X-Ratelimit-Reset-After') | ||
lockout.lock_for(reset_after) | ||
""" | ||
|
||
def __init__(self) -> None: | ||
self._lockouts: list[float] = [] | ||
|
||
def lockout_for(self, seconds: float): | ||
"""Lock a resource for an amount of time.""" | ||
heapq.heappush(self._lockouts, time.monotonic() + seconds) | ||
|
||
async def __aenter__(self) -> None: | ||
while self._lockouts: | ||
now = time.monotonic() | ||
# There must not be an async context switch between here | ||
# and replacing the lockout when lockout is in the future | ||
ts = heapq.heappop(self._lockouts) | ||
if (sleep_for := ts - now) > 0: | ||
heapq.heappush(self._lockouts, ts) | ||
await asyncio.sleep(sleep_for) | ||
|
||
async def __aexit__(self, exc_type: type[Exception], exc: Exception, tb: TracebackType): | ||
pass |
